White Potatoe

White potato is a starchy tuber commonly eaten baked, boiled, mashed, or roasted. It provides energy and can be a nutritious whole food when prepared with minimal added fat, salt, or sugar.

Beneficial properties

good source of potassium provides complex carbohydrates contains vitamin C contains resistant starch when cooled naturally fat-free

Nutritional highlights

White potato provides carbohydrates, potassium, vitamin C, vitamin B6, and smaller amounts of fiber, especially when eaten with the skin.

Caution. Potatoes have a high glycemic impact when heavily processed or eaten in large portions, which may be a concern for people managing blood sugar.
